A member asked:

Excruciating pain during bowel movement with hemorrhoid. should i try prep h?

Bowel Movement Pain: Pain during bowel movements are usually due to anal fissures (tears in the lining of the anus) or external hemorrhoids which have formed clots inside of them. The best thing to do is to see your physician who can accurately diagnose you and recommend the appropriate treatment.

Already answered: Probably you have an anal fissure especially if it is a tearing sensation with a bowel movement. You need to see a colorectal surgeon for confirmation and appropriate treatment.
